Description

Alocasia portei ’Malaysian Monster’ is an impressive and spectacular houseplant known for its large, deeply cut leaves, which give it a wild yet elegant appearance. The dark green, almost tropical leaves can grow to considerable sizes, creating a striking visual effect that immediately attracts attention. This variety is ideal for large spaces or as a centerpiece in an exotic plant collection.

Origin: Alocasia portei is native to the rainforests of Malaysia and Southeast Asia. The cultivar ’Malaysian Monster’ is prized for the size and spectacular shape of its leaves, which are both broad and deeply lobed.

Growth: This plant can reach an impressive height of 1.5 to 2.5 meters indoors, with leaves that can exceed 1 meter in length. It grows quickly under optimal conditions of light, warmth, and humidity, and it regularly produces new leaves.

Flowers: The flowers of Alocasia portei ’Malaysian Monster’ are small and inconspicuous, appearing as white or greenish spathes. However, the plant is primarily grown for its striking foliage rather than its flowers.

Light: It prefers bright but indirect light. Direct light can cause burns on large leaves, while insufficient light can slow growth and reduce the intensity of the green leaves.

Watering: Water regularly to keep the soil evenly moist, but avoid leaving it soggy. Allow the soil surface to dry slightly between waterings to prevent root rot. In winter, reduce watering frequency depending on plant activity.

Substrate: Use a well-draining potting soil suitable for tropical plants. A mix rich in organic matter is recommended to retain moisture while ensuring good drainage. Drainage is essential to avoid problems related to overwatering.

Toxicity: Alocasia portei ’Malaysian Monster’ is toxic to animals and humans if ingested. The sap can also cause skin irritation, so careful handling is recommended.
